Greenjp wrote:
Education :shock: You mean ppl who spend too much time in school are shitty drivers???

Higher education actually equals quite a substantial discount

Its funny
Person A as primary, Person B as secondary gets one rate
Now call back and get a second quote with Person B as primary and Person A as secondary

I fail to see how different University degree levels equates to better driving but there you have it
Using 2 identical people gets huge savings based on whose name is listed first on the policy


I am sure this discrimination also extends to college / high school if anyone else wants to test it
